To be honest our story is kind of embarrassing but everyone seems to love it.

When I was 12 I played games online (before there was really internet, there was the Imagination Network...I think that's what it was called) and my husband and I used to play games online together (he was 14). We started writing letters to each other (snail mail my friends...I didn't have internet in my house until I was 15) and we continued via email once we got internet and remained friends throughout the years (he living in New York and I in California).

We lost touch a bit my first two years of college but reconnected when I received an email from him. We have always been friends but the summer between junior and senior year of college I spent the summer in Boston with my best friend and decided to pay him a visit in New York...

A little romance blossomed, a 2 1/2 year long distance relationship and now 10 years later we've been married for five years and have two beautiful babies together!

I am now 30 and I've known my husband for almost 18 years and I learn more and more about him every day!
